Output 8d8e8020acac0a1058ef53c1761faf1b238a20a2e662a7b994dc9bfab52a009a:0

value
1002907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 577cd69295f204b3a03cb3e9f13041e23c8856c0 OP_EQUAL
address
39fcG99xFSmBYN9AGKKp9USnxBuXpu7fxk
transaction
8d8e8020acac0a1058ef53c1761faf1b238a20a2e662a7b994dc9bfab52a009a
spent
true